Interfaces oriented designing pdf download

Enhancing integrated environmental modelling by designing. Chapter14 graphical user interfaces building java programs. Communication oriented techniques 97803033892 overview an excellent introduction to the design theories involved in the creation of. Learn design concepts that are often misunderstood, such as affordances, visual hierarchy, navigational distance, and the. This site is like a library, use search box in the widget to get ebook that you want. Here you can download the free lecture notes of service oriented architecture pdf notes soa pdf notes materials with multiple file links to download. The supporting information is available free of charge on the acs publications website at doi. Object oriented programming oop is an approach to program organization and development that attempts to eliminate some of the pitfalls of conventional programming methods by incorporating the best of structured programming features with several powerful new concepts. In computing, an interface is a shared boundary across which two or more separate. Enhancing integrated environmental modelling by designing resourceoriented interfaces. Generative patterns for designing multiple user interfaces. Voice user interfaces vuis are becoming all the rage today. Inheritance and interfaces by ken pugh published by pragmatic bookshelf.

The online and pdf versions of this book are created. In computing, an objectoriented user interface ooui is a type of user interface based on an objectoriented programming metaphor. This content was uploaded by our users and we assume good faith they have the permission to share this book. Australasian conference on information systems dodd, athauda, and adam. Finally, the chapter takes a look at setting up a small project with javafx, so we can get a feel for how everything works and decide ourselves whether we want to continue with this ui toolkit and leave swing behind.

A standard interface, such as scsi, decouples the design and introduction of computing. This tutorial teaches program design in a format even beginning programmers can understand. Implementing drawingpanel initial version without events second version with events chapter14 graphical user interfaces 822. Whether youre designing a mobile app, a toy, or a device such as a home assistant, this practical book guides you through basic vui design principles, helps you choose the right speech recognition engine, and shows you how to measure your vuis performance and. Youll learn by pragmatic example how to create effective designs composed of interfaces to objects, components and services. In proceedings of the chi 2002 conference on human factors in computing pp. The objectoriented thought process, 5th edition book. An object oriented approach to webbased application design. More than many other aspects of java, interfaces help you build modular code. Interface oriented design focuses on an important, but often neglected, aspect of objectoriented design. Unfortunately, the world is awash with objectoriented oo applications that are difficult to understand and expensive to change. Its powerful advantage range from productivity and maintainability to portability and reuse. Many vector drawing applications, for example, have an ooui the objects being lines, circles and canvases.

Designing responsive photonic crystal patterns by using. Object oriented design download ebook pdf, epub, tuebl, mobi. Thursday, february 27, 2020 admin comments0 anyone whos serious about designing interfaces should have this book on their shelf for. In some objectoriented languages, especially those without full multiple inheritance, the. In this updated designing interfaces, 3rd edition, youll. Interface design best practices in objectoriented api design in java is a free online java book. Often modules that implement pizzaordering interfaces are not even objectoriented. Designing interfaces pdf download anyone whos serious about designing interfaces should have this book on their shelf for reference. Pdf designing voice user interfaces download full pdf.

Designing visual interfaces communication oriented. Designing voice user interfaces available for download and read online in other formats. Designing bots download ebook pdf, epub, tuebl, mobi. Communication oriented techniques 97803033892 overview an excellent introduction to the design theories involved in the creation of user interfaces. Audience this tutorial has been designed to help beginners. First, take a tightlycoupled system design without interfaces, spot its deficiencies and then walkthrough a solution of the problem with a design using interfaces. Essentially, each keystroke required to accomplish a particular task is tallied. Heuristics for designing enjoyable user interfaces. Download designing objectoriented software pdf ebook. Unlimited downloads resource for free downloading latest, most popular and best selling information technology pdf ebooks and video tutorials.

Objectoriented thought process, the, 4th edition informit. Download user interfaces for all ebook free in pdf and epub format. Download user interfaces for all is the first book dedicated to the issues of universal design and universal access in the field of humancomputer interaction hci. Pdf working with java interfaces and classes how to maximize. Ironically, many designers of graphical user interfaces are not always aware of the fundamental design rules and techniques that are applied routinely by other practitioners of communicationoriented visual design techniques that can be used to enhance the visual quality of. Objects also form the basis for many web technologies selection from the. Ssooffttwwaarree uusseerr iinntteerrffaaccee ddeessiiggnn user interface is the frontend application view to which user interacts in order to use the software. Android user interface design implementing material design for developers second edition ian g. The structured programming approach to program design was. The term objectoriented direct manipulation interfaces defines a class of interfaces that rely on concrete and visible objects, simplified sets of user actions, and rapid feedback where the key activity is visibly moving screen images by pointing at them. But to take full advantage of objects, its not enough for programmers to apply rote techniques. Interfaceoriented design explores how you can develop software with.

An experience design framework, which you can download on the website of ux magazine. Pdf download designing objectoriented user interfaces addisonwesley object technology joonyoung01. Interface design best practices in objectoriented api. Designing interfaces, 3rd edition free pdf download. But how do you build one that people can actually converse with.

User interface design umd department of computer science. Objectoriented bootcamp 9 interfaces vs abstract classes. Patterns for effective interaction design, 2nd edition. Object oriented analysis and design notes pdf ooad notes pdf ooad notes pdf. Click download or read online button to get object oriented design book now. To take full advantage of java, or of any of todays objectoriented languages, programmers must learn fundamental design principles as well as the syntax of code. Designing mobile interfaces by steven hoober and eric berkman. If you are involved in designing user interfaces, this book is for you. In an ooui, the user interacts explicitly with objects that represent entities in the domain that the application is concerned with.

By the end of the book you will have a vision of the future, imagining new useroriented scenarios and new avenues, which until now were untouched. Object oriented analysis and design pdf notes ooad pdf notes. It is a new way of organizing and developing programs and has. Practical objectoriented design, second edition, immerses you in an oo mindset and teaches you powerful, realworld, objectoriented design techniques with simple and practical examples. Furthermore, many java programs are meant to be downloaded over a network. Clifton new york boston indianapolis san francisco toronto montreal london munich paris madrid cape town sydney tokyo singapore mexico city. Pdf modern software architectures heavily promote the use of interfaces. Object oriented analysis and design notes pdf ooad notes pdf ooad notes pdf file to download are listed below please check it. Objectoriented bootcamp 8 interfaces hd zahirularb. Free download pdf ebook designing visual interfaces. Patterns for effective interaction design, 3rd edition designing good application interfaces isnt easy now that.

Click download or read online button to get designing bots book now. Today, user interface is found at almost every place where digital technology exists, right from. User can manipulate and control the software as well as hardware by means of user interface. Anyone whos serious about designing interfaces should have this book on their shelf for reference. To add behavior to graphical interfaces, one first needs an introduction to the concept of events.

Service oriented architecture notes pdf soa notes pdf book starts with the topics xml document structure, the roots of soa, define business automation requirements, identify existing. If youre looking for a free download links of designing objectoriented software pdf, epub, docx and torrent then this site is not for you. Download pdf designing voice user interfaces book full free. The interfaces may be procedure oriented such as remote procedure calls or document oriented such. Object oriented analysis and design pdf notes ooad pdf. Exercise caution when depending on private interfaces 79. Often, programmers express that commonality using an inheritance hierarchy, since that is. In fact, design patterns as a whole were first discovered in smalltalk. The example used throughout the article is the design of a naming service, as defined by the corba. This book explains how to create effective graphical user interfaces by using objectoriented methods and tools. Its the most comprehensive crossplatform examination of common interface patterns anywhere.

Pdf user interfaces for all download ebook for free. A framework for designing intelligent taskoriented. The factory pattern was invented in smalltalk, which doesnt have interfaces. Graphic challenges in designing objectoriented user.

A key point in designing resourceoriented interfaces is the identification and description of the state transitions to support linkages between resources. Service oriented architecture pdf notes soa pdf notes. The guidelines put forth in this book will primarily. User interface design designing effective interfaces for software systems importance of user interface 2 system users often judge a system by its interface rather than its functionality a poorly designed interface can cause a user to make catastrophic errors poor user interface design is the reason why so many software systems. Design engaging and usable interfaces with more confidence and less guesswork. Designing good application interfaces isnt easy now that companies need to create compelling, seamless user experiences across an exploding number of channels, screens, and contexts. Best place to read online information technology articles, research topics and case studies. With the advent of objectoriented programming, classes quickly became the. Our solutions are expressed in terms of objects and interfaces instead of walls and doors, but at the core of both kinds of.